Component Quality Specialist
Position:
Component Quality Specialist
Job Description:
Responsibilities
The CQS works directly with the Component Quality Engineers (CQE’s) and Engineering Technicians to ensure that components are inspected and tested in accordance with various internal and external inspection standards to confirm the authenticity and condition of the components being inspected. The CQS utilizes various pieces of equipment and gathers data based on the inspection process to verify all aspects of electronic components conditions for fit, form and functionality. The CQS utilizes all the data gathered during the inspection process and makes recommendations on the parts condition and overall status.
Accountabilities
- Inspects and tests components in accordance with documented internal forms and procedures.
- Creatively gathers, analyzes, interprets, and utilizes manufacturers and other specification sheets in order to complete the physical inspection of the components and draw conclusions as to the component condition.
- Provides test results to the proper personnel and teams accurately in written and verbal fashion as required
- Takes digital images of components as required.
- Communicates with other team members to draw conclusions and make decisions.
- Provides Engineering Technicians with direction to help complete the inspection process.
- Works in accordance with ISO and ESD procedures as well as others.
